#b937c6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b937c6 is composed of 72.5% red, 21.6%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.6% cyan, 72.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 294.5 degrees, a saturation of 56.5% and a lightness of 49.6%. #b937c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6eff with #73008d.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#b937c6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d040e is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b937c6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817b82 is the less saturated color, while #e106f7 is the most saturated one.
